For your last challenge, I challenge you to create a layout in a size that you're not typically used to making.  For example, if you typically create 12"x12" layouts, create a 8.5"x11" layout instead!
***

I created this layout in a size that I typically don't scrap in:  6"x8".  This is going into my travel album dedicated to my most recent travels to Tokyo, Japan (which you'll see more of in my PL posts this month).

It's a simple layout in which I layered some of the cut-apart papers from the 6x6 pad over a full sheet.  I didn't want to cut apart the full sheet because I loved the quote that was on it.  The size of the sheet ended up working out perfectly with the size of my layout.  Then I added some fussy cut  elements plus some embellishments from the PL kit.
